We all know Pi-hole, which is an awesome software. Sadly, it does not fit my requirements.
First of all, it's only available at home, which is a total deal-breaker for me since I only work on mobile devices (laptop, smartphone) that come and go out of my house every day. Which means I can't set my system resolver to PiHole because it wouldn't work when I leave home and if I let DHCP managing my DNS settings, I'll be using random DNS servers outside home.
I have successfully set up a WireGuard server with Pi-hole set as a resolver, on a VM in the cloud. That... works, but I don't want to be connected to a VPN all the time.
To put it simply, Pi-hole does not tick essential boxes here, so it's disqualified for my use-case.
Despite how much I like Cloudflare and this specific service, I want to block trackers at the DNS level. 1.1.1.1 is probably the most reliable and fastest resolver there is on earth, but that does not fit my use case either. 😕
For the past year and a half, I have been using AdGuard DNS (not their software). I have been using the DoT endpoint from my Android phone and the DoH endpoint from my Mac trough dnscrypt-proxy, and it's been working perfectly.
They have been super reliable for me. They seem to have an Anycast network, although limited.
